⭐Attend the Academy Orchestra rehearsals with Gustavo Gimeno and Francisco Coll, including the Portuguese premiere of his piece 'Hímnica'</description><pubDate>Mon, 23 Feb 2026 17:35:30 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/courses/10863?ref=51</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/courses/10863?ref=51</guid></item><item><title>Concorso Fondazione Monini - nuove composizioni vocali da camera</title><description>Teatro Lirico Sperimentale and Fondazione Monini announce the "Concorso Fondazione Monini" – Dedicated to the memory of maestro Gian Carlo Menotti – for new vocal chamber compositions, 2026 edition.&#13;
&#13;
The competition is open to composers under 35 of any nationality, who may submit compositions for voice (register of their choice) and piano, unpublished and never performed, with a maximum duration of ten minutes. The works must use a freely chosen poetic text and may be presented as a single piece or as a cycle of several pieces, provided they are within the time limit.&#13;
&#13;
The winner will receive a prize of €4,000 and the composition will be premiered in Spoleto, at the Sala Pegasus, during the 80th Experimental Opera Season, during a Liederabend dedicated to vocal chamber music.&#13;
&#13;
Scores must be submitted by 23:59 on 20 April 2026, in accordance with the instructions provided in the announcement on the Institution's website.</description><pubDate>Mon, 23 Feb 2026 15:48:26 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5837</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5837</guid></item><item><title>Garda Lake Music Excellence - Prestige Academy 2026</title><description>Garda Lake Music Excellence XIV EDITION&#13;

* COMPOSITION Mauro Montalbetti</description><pubDate>Mon, 23 Feb 2026 15:11:35 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/courses/10861?ref=51</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/courses/10861?ref=51</guid></item><item><title>2028 Azrieli Music Prizes</title><description>Created in 2014 by Sharon Azrieli CQ for the Azrieli Foundation, the Azrieli Music Prizes (AMP) offer opportunities for the discovery, creation, performance and celebration of excellence in music composition. For the 2028 edition, there are three Prizes for chamber music (up to 15 musicians): the Azrieli Commission for Jewish Music; the Azrieli Commission for Canadian Music; and the Azrieli Commission for International Music. Offering the most substantial awards of its kind in Canada, AMP has become one of the most significant composition competitions in the world. There is no fee to apply.&#13;
&#13;
The musical works resulting from each of the three Prizes will be awarded a cash prize of $50,000 CAD; premiered at the AMP Gala Concert in Montreal in Fall 2028; given two subsequent international performances; and  professionally recorded for a future commercial release.   &#13;
&#13;
Altogether, the prize package for each Azrieli Music Prize is valued at over $250,000 CAD.</description><pubDate>Fri, 20 Feb 2026 00:00:00 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5831</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5831</guid></item><item><title>Bartók World Competition - Composition 2026</title><description>The Bartók World Competition 2026 is open for applications. The selection is open to composers of all nationalities, over the age of 18 and under 30 on the 15th of October 2026.</description><pubDate>Sun, 01 Feb 2026 00:00:00 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5770</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5770</guid></item><item><title>Earplay Donald Aird Composers Competition</title><description>Earplay sponsors the annual Earplay Donald Aird Composers Competition, open to composers of any nationality and any age. Earplay performs the winning piece in San Francisco in 2027 and presents a cash prize of $1,500 to the composer. &#13;
&#13;
Works are limited to 1 to 6 players (at most 1 of each, e.g., not 2 violins) from Earplay's ensemble: flute/piccolo/alto flute/bass flute; clarinet/bass clarinet; piano; violin; viola; cello. Works may include electronics. Works may be of any duration (8-15 minutes preferred) and may have been previously performed. Each composer can submit any number of pieces.&#13;
&#13;
Application deadline is April 30, 2026 11:59pm PST. Application fee of $30 USD (waivers available).</description><pubDate>Sat, 31 Jan 2026 18:35:12 +0000</pubDate><link>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5771</link><guid>https://www.musicalchairs.info/competitions/5771</guid></item><item><title>HR Manager</title><description>CDD à plein-temps – 12 mois&#13;
